We deny about 60-70% of applications that come through as there's just that many people trying to defraud the system. If you answer the phone and know about affiliate marketing we won't deny yah. But if you're name is Tom Jones with a US address, your IP is from China, India, other various countries or a Proxy we'll auto deny you. Just to many people trying to make a quick buck by defrauding the system out there.

Couple tips for getting approved quicker.

1. Talk a bit about your affiliate marketing knowledge.
2. Put WF as your ref and then share your screen name in the notes so we can look you up.
3. When you submit your application call right afterwards

If you do those 3 things our ability to evaluate you a "real" affiliate go up 100%.
